Strictly Come Dancing contestant Adam Thomas has been dealt a blow before he dances on the second week of Strictly.

The star earned 19 points with his first dance of the series after opening the show last week, and it looks like he could be set to get a similar low result this week. In fact, bookies have him down as one of the first to be eliminated. Last week he was third from the bottom on the Strictly leaderboard, with Zara McDermott, Nikita Kanda and Les Dennis finishing below him.

As Strictly heads into its second week and the first elimination, it seems the Emmerdale actor's odds "increased massively" according to Gambling.co.uk's James Leyfield.

Leyfield told GB News: "Les [Dennis] is still propping up the Strictly market on betting apps at a massive 150/1 and he is just 15/8 to be the first star eliminated.'

Highlighting Adam, Leyfield then said: "Meanwhile, Adam Thomas' odds have increased massively this week to 50/1. He is a big 14/1 outsider to go first. The former Emmerdale star may well have the soap fan support to rely on to keep him in the competition until at least week two, but it might be worth a go given his odds for Glitterball glory."

After his first dance on Strictly last week, Adam and dance partner Luba were criticised for playing it safe with a "dull" routine. Former Strictly professional Brendan Cole said in a scathing interview with Sky Bingo: "I think his partner needs to do better. I didn't like the choreography choice. I didn't like the set to start the show. I mean, that could be production intervening and going, 'we want this', but for me it lacked, it seemed like an average routine."

He continued: "It was opening the show so that was kind of odd. I was pleased to watch him because he's really nice to watch, but at the end, it was kind of dull, but I don't think it's his fault. I think he could do really, really well, but it's going to take some very clever stuff between them to make it right. I thought it was an average looking number for somebody who should be quite fun to watch."

Adam has opened up about his struggle for dancing after he was diagnosed with rheumatoid Arthritis in January. Speaking exclusively to the Mirror, he revealed: "I’ve not talked about this before but no-one really knows the pain I’ve been going through. I put on a brave face but it’s been difficult to keep that persona up. Emotionally and physically, it’s had a huge impact on my life this year."
